2 definitions by Lolvscosksksksksks

If the feeling of your period blood fastly releasing itself from your vagina when you laugh or sneeze made a sound it would sound like the word ‘hemoglobin’.
OMG sis, I just hemoglobined!!!
by Lolvscosksksksksks September 23, 2019
Get the Hemoglobin mug.
A trend from the 80’s that Amber re-popularised in 2017.
Oh look at Amber wearing all those scrunchies to steer into the skid of judgment.
by Lolvscosksksksksks September 23, 2019
Get the Scrunchie mug.